Maturing our Social Media: No Longer an Afterthought JDS Academy Sharefest May 14, 2013
Leveraging Our Social Media Resources
Website • Launched weekly “pushpage” newsletter – published every Thursday Kol Carmel – The Voice Of Carmel Facebook • Update 3X a week with engaging content, photos, photo albums and some video Twitter • Update at least 3X a week. Experiment with pushing people to Facebook and our website.

How Do We Make it Work • Monthly and Weekly Editorial Calendar – Plan ahead • Share content across social media platforms – Website homepage, Weekly Newsletter, Facebook, Twitter.
• Photographers – Identify various staff members to take photos and synch with editorial calendar.
• Make it exciting for faculty’s hard work to be featured or highlighted so they become content contributors.

What’s the Difference? • Increased community interaction. People are hitting like, leaving comments, sharing.
• More consistent, meaningful, engaging content
• Measurable increased readership of weekly newsletter. Consistently over 50 percent each week vs. last year when it was about 20 percent readership
• Alumni families who we had never heard from on Facebook are liking and commenting on posts. Unprecedented attendance at Annual Dinner.
• Facebook, web-based pushpages and Twitter have become part of the fabric of our communications culture.
